MySQL命令行窗口未打开

问题描述 投票:0回答:3

qazxsw POI] qazxsw POI mysql安装成功我想,但是当我尝试打开命令行客户端的我,它打开的一瞬间然后关闭,与其他人的堆栈溢出。

当去任务管理器>服务选项卡,并试图启动mysql,我得到“拒绝访问”错误。所以,我跟进别人的意见去控制面板/管理工具,设法在那里启动MySQL。我得到以下错误的窗口!

服务“本地计算机上的MySQL服务(标题栏)启动后又停止。如果他们不被其他服务或程序使用的一些服务自动停止“。

OK按钮右下角。

抱歉,我不能在这里粘贴错误窗口!

我不知道该解决方案将是现在。

在此先感谢,男

mysql install
3个回答
0
投票

现在有几个你必须遵循的步骤。因为似乎一个安装或配置错误。

从您的设备完全删除首先MySQL的。从控制面板卸载。删除驱动器文件,它在安装了一个文件夹。

从最开始重新安装的MySQL。

有使用注册表编辑器工具,配件还有其他的选择。

与它其他的问题,我能感觉到一些其他的过程中不让它执行。所以,你可以使用命令提示符下杀掉该进程,然后再次启动它。

但现在我会建议只是重新安装它,什么也不做平行而安装。安装后只需重新启动您的设备,它会肯定的工作。

不过,如果你有困难我来这里是肯定的。


0
投票

为他人的优点:

我试图删除在MySQL的文件夹中的所有文件和卸载(这是不可能的,除了连接器.NET)所有MySQL程序,然后试图重新安装的MySQL。

我MySQL服务器(下图)的配置期间中号实际上得到的误差 - 所有其他步骤均正确配置,邻它是DEFO此步骤导致该错误。

我也尝试过很短暂停止我的防火墙,但没有帮助。

以下是在配置日志文件中的信息,如果是有意义的人。

开始配置步骤:停止服务器[如果需要的话]端配置步骤:停止服务器[如果需要的话]

开始的配置步骤:写配置文件端配置步:写配置文件

开始配置步骤:更新防火墙端口3306成功添加防火墙规则添加防火墙规则MySQL80。端配置步骤:更新防火墙

开始的配置步骤:调整Windows服务[如有必要]试图授予网络服务需要的文件系统权限。授予的权限。添加新服务新的服务添加端的配置步骤:调整Windows服务[必要时]

开始的配置步骤:初始化数据库[如有必要]删除数据文件夹出货试图与--Initialize不安全的运行过程中运行MySQL服务器:C:\ Program Files文件\的MySQL \ MySQL服务器8.0 \ BIN \ mysqld.exe --defaults文件= “C:\ ProgramData \ MySQL的\ MySQL服务器8.0 \ my.ini的” --initialize不安全=上--console等待服务器停止:C:\ Program Files文件\的MySQL \ MySQL服务器8.0 \ BIN \ mysqld.exe --defaults文件= “C:\ ProgramData \的MySQL \ MySQL服务器8.0 \的my.ini” --initialize不安全=上--console 2018-09-10T19:31:0 39.510737Z [ERROR] [MY-011071 ] [服务器]未知后缀 ''用于变量 '的lower_case_table_names'(值 '0.0')2018-09-10T19:31:0 39.510737Z [ERROR] [MY-011071] [服务器] C:\ Program Files文件\的MySQL \ MySQL服务器8.0 \ BIN \ mysqld的。 exe文件:在设置值 '0.0' 到 '的lower_case_table_names' 2018-09-10T19错误:31:0 39.526337Z [ERROR] [MY-010119] [服务器]中止2018-09-10T19:31:0 39.526337Z [注] [MY-010120] [服务器] BINLOG结束初始化数据库失败端配置步骤的尝试:初始化数据库[如果需要的话]

开始的配置步骤:启动服务器启动MySQL作为一个服务

This is a screenshot of error dialog after trying to start mysql57 from Task Manager[![][1]


0
投票

这将是有益的,如果你能够把任何截图或录像。当你的错误似乎是可以解决的,但没有确切的了解,这将是只是一个假设。一旦你分享我一定能解决您的错误。

信息在上面的窗口复制了日志选项卡: - 开始的配置步骤:写配置文件端配置步:写配置文件开始配置步:更新Windows防火墙规则试图删除Windows防火墙规则与命令:netsh.exe中advfirewall防火墙删除规则名称= “端口3306” 协议= TCP将localPort = 3306删除1规则(一个或多个)。好。端口3306尝试添加Windows防火墙规则与命令添加Windows防火墙规则MySQL80:netsh.exe中advfirewall防火墙添加规则名称=“3306端口”协议= TCP将localPort = 3306 DIR =行动=允许好吧。成功加入Windows防火墙规则。端的配置步骤:更新Windows防火墙规则开始的配置步骤:调整Windows服务试图授予网络服务需要的文件系统权限。授予的权限。添加新服务新的服务添加端的配置步骤:调整Windows服务开始的配置步骤:初始化数据库试图与MySQL服务器8.0.11 ...用命令启动过程--initialize不安全选项...启动进程运行MySQL服务器: C:\ Program Files文件\的MySQL \ MySQL服务器8.0 \ BIN \ mysqld.exe --defaults文件= “C:\ ProgramData \ MySQL的\ MySQL服务器8.0 \ my.ini的” --console --initialize不安全=上。 .. 2019-01-17T21:00:0 17.450875Z [ERROR] [MY-011071] [服务器]未知后缀'。用于变量 '的lower_case_table_names'(值 '0.0')2019-01-17T21:00:0 17.450926Z [ERROR] [MY-011071] [服务器] C:\ Program Files文件\的MySQL \ MySQL服务器8.0 \ BIN \ mysqld的。 exe文件:在设置值 '0.0' 到 '的lower_case_table_names' 2019-01-17T21错误:00:0 17.451367Z [ERROR] [MY-010119] [服务器]中止2019-01-17T21:00:0 17.451477Z [注] [MY-010120] [服务器] BINLOG端工艺的mysqld,与ID 9456,被成功地运行,并且与代码1退出无法为MySQL服务器8.0.11启动过程。数据库初始化失败。端配置步骤:初始化数据库

© www.soinside.com 2019 - 2024. All rights reserved.